Bridge Snapshot: Hog Island road
The Hog Island road bridge in Delaware, Pennsylvania carries Hog Island road over Hog Island Stream. It was built in 2001, making it 25 years old today. The structure is built primarily of concrete and spans 1 section, stretching 14.0 meters (46 feet) end to end. Daily traffic averages 500 vehicles, placing it in the lower-traffic tier of Pennsylvania bridges. It is owned and maintained by City/Municipal Highway Agency.
The latest FHWA inspection records show culvert at 7/9. The weakest component sits in good condition. All reported major components score above the Poor range. Its NBI inventory load rating is 32.7 metric tons.

This page shows what the last federal inspection recorded, not whether Hog Island road is safe to cross today. Here is how to use it.
- NBI condition ratings reflect the latest record in this annual dataset, not a live status. Current routine inspection intervals are risk-based.

Condition codes come straight from the FHWA National Bridge Inventory and are not a real-time safety judgment. Only the owning agency, a state DOT, county, or other owner, can post, restrict, or close a bridge.
